| Birth: | Dec. 31, 1803 Burlington County New Jersey, USA | | Death: | May 25, 1870 Princeton Mercer County New Jersey, USA |  Civil War US Senator. He served as a New Jersey state Representative from 1833 to 1834, a member of the New Jersey General Assembly in 1837, and New Jersey Attorney General from 1838-1841, and United States Senator from New Jersey from 1862 to 1863. He was a professor at the Princeton Law School from 1847 to 1855. He was the grandson of Declaration of Independence Signer Richard Stockton.
